Understanding the Link Between Railroad Work and Cancer

Railroad workers face various health risks due to their working environment. The main dangerous products in this market include:

  • Asbestos: Commonly used for insulation and fireproofing.
  • Diesel Exhaust: Emitted from locomotives and other heavy equipment.
  • Benzene: Often discovered in items utilized for cleaning and equipment upkeep.
  • Toluene and Xylene: Solvents that can be damaging with repetitive exposure.

The direct exposure to these toxins can increase the risk of a number of kinds of cancer, consisting of:

  • Lung cancer
  • Mesothelioma
  • Bladder cancer
  • Leukemia
  • Laryngeal cancer

Comprehending the underlying health risks can help those impacted by these illness acknowledge their right to seek monetary payment through settlement claims.

Elements Influencing Railroad Cancer Settlement Amounts

Settlement amounts can vary considerably based on a number of aspects. Here are some crucial considerations:

  1. Type of Cancer: Different cancers have differing links to Railroad Settlement All work and can influence settlement amounts. For example:

    • Mesothelioma cases normally command higher settlements due to the aggressive nature of the disease and the established links to asbestos.
    • Lung cancer can also lead to significant settlements, especially if tied to extended direct exposure to diesel exhaust.
  2. Intensity of Illness: The phase of the cancer at diagnosis and overall diagnosis can impact the payment quantity.

  3. Length of Employment: Longer direct exposure to damaging substances may strengthen a claim, as it might suggest neglect from the company in providing safe working conditions.

  4. Documentation: A well-documented case with strong medical proof and evidence of exposure can cause higher settlements.

  5. Legal Representation: Experienced attorneys specializing in railroad cancer claims can negotiate much better settlements due to their understanding of the intricacies of the law.

  6. State Laws: Different states have differing statutes relating to office injury and poisonous tort claims. This can impact both the possibility of a successful claim and the potential quantity gotten.

The Process of Pursuing a Settlement

Here are steps that Railroad Settlement workers or their families should take when pursuing a cancer settlement:

  1. Consultation with Legal Experts: Seek a knowledgeable attorney familiar with FELA (Federal Employers Liability Act) or other pertinent statutes.

  2. Gather Documentation:

    • Medical records
    • Employment history
    • Evidence of exposure to dangerous materials
  3. Work out with Employers or Insurers: Settlement settlements might occur with the railroad company or liability insurance companies.

  4. Submit a Claim: If negotiations are unsuccessful, it might be required to file an official claim or lawsuit.

  5. Prepare for Court: Although numerous cases settle out of court, being gotten ready for a trial might affect settlements.
